Runbook: Tariffly tax-rate cache. The lookup cache sits between the checkout service and the upstream rate provider. If rates look stale, check cache TTL first — most incidents are someone bumping it during a provider outage and forgetting to revert. Flush via the admin endpoint, never by restarting the pod; restarts drop in-flight lookups. Warm-up takes about two minutes; expect elevated latency until then. Escalate only if misses stay above 20% after warm-up. Current cache configuration follows.

settings of tagef-bawif:
DRUIX_HOST=druix.zemvarlabs.internal
DRUIX_PORT=8000

Subject: Survey crate for Harlow Ridge

Dispatch team,

The crate of Veltrix survey instruments is packed and waiting at Bay 3. It's booked with Quickspan Couriers for tomorrow morning, going to the Harlow Ridge site office. Contents are calibrated, so flag it as fragile and keep it upright. The hand-over instruction for the courier is below.

handover note for yagef-bagep: the drudor pelius courier leaves the kasdor zorvan norir ledger at gate 8016 under passcode 755406

The garage occupancy feed for the Brindlewood campus arrives over a message queue every thirty seconds, one record per level, published by the Stallgrid edge boxes. Counts can briefly go negative when a sensor double-fires on exit; the ingest job clamps these to zero and flags the interval. If the feed stalls for more than five minutes, the dashboard falls back to the last known snapshot. Sensor mappings, queue names, and the replay procedure are documented on the internal page below.

runbook for tahog-kadug: https://gitlab.qirvanworks.corp/projects/pages/view/b139298aed28